Fundraiser for Local Firefighter Battling Stage 4 Cancer

Firefighter Mike Solberg, the son of Palatine Councilman Greg Solberg, was recently sworn into the Schaumburg Fire Department. Just weeks ago he was diagnosed with Stage 4 brain cancer. A fundraiser is being held to assist him, his wife and young daughter

 

In October, Mike Solberg, the son of Palatine Village Councilman Greg Solberg, realized his dreams and was sworn into the Schaumburg Fire Department. And just a couple of weeks ago, the young firefighter who lives in Park Ridge, learned he has stage 4 brain cancer. 

A fundraiser will be held by his fellow firefighters this coming Sunday. 

"We just wanted to help out our brother, we wanted to help his family and no one should go through this alone," said Jeanine Kubalewski, a Schaumburg firefighter who volunteered to help organize the event. 

Solberg and his wife Maureen have a 21-month old daughter named Emma. 

The event, which is open to the public, will be held Sunday, December 16 at John Barleycorn, 1100 American Lane, Schaumburg from 10 a.m. until 4 p.m.

A $5 donation will be taken at the door. 

There also will be 50/50 raffles, an iPad raffle, squares for the Bears/Packers game, and gray awareness bracelets available for purchase.
